導航:首頁 > 源碼編譯 > 用c編譯如何求三位數各位數之和

用c編譯如何求三位數各位數之和

發布時間:2023-01-03 11:57:03

❶ C語言編程題目:輸入一個三位數,輸出各個數位上的數字及它們的和。

#include <stdio.h>

void main()

{

int a;

int b,c,d;//各個位數上的數字

printf("請輸入一個三位數:");

scanf("%d",&a);

b=a/100; //百位

c=(a-b*100)/10; //十位

d=a%10; //個位

printf("百位:%d ,十位:%d ,個位%d ",b,c,d);

printf("它們的和是:%d ",b+c+d);

}

❷ 如何編寫一個程序,實現如下功能:從鍵盤輸入一個三位整數,求各位數字之和

程序如下: #include<stdio.h>
#define N 5
void main()
{
int a,b,c,n;
int sum=0;
printf("輸入一個三位數:\n");
scanf("%d",&n);
a=n/100;
b=n/10%10;
c=n%10;
sum=a+b+c;
printf("各位數字之和是: %d\n",sum);
}
有疑問提出。 望採納哦~~

❸ C語言求一個三位數的各位數和

//C語言求一個三位數的各位數和

#include <stdio.h>

int main(void)
{

int Num=0;

scanf("%d",&Num);

printf("百位:%d\n",Num/100);
printf("十位:%d\n",Num/10%10);
printf("各位:%d\n",Num%10);

puts("");
int Sum=Num/100+Num/10%10+Num%10;
printf("%d+%d+%d=%d\n",Num/100,Num/10%10,Num%10,Sum);

puts("");

return 0;
}

❹ C語言程序如何求三個數的和

C語言程序:

#include<stdio.h>

voidmain()
{
inta,b,c;
intsum;

printf("請輸入三個數,以空格分隔:");
scanf("%d%d%d",&a,&b,&c);

sum=a+b+c;

printf("%d、%d、%d三個數之和:%d ",a,b,c,sum);
}

運行測試:

請輸入三個數,以空格分隔:321
3、2、1三個數之和:6

❺ 用C語言寫出輸入一個三位的整數,計算這個數各位數值之和. 誰知道 要准確 高人來

呵呵,那我發一個全的吧,一樓的朋友有點懶啊!
#include<stdio.h>
void main()
{
int num;
int ge ;
int shi ;
int ;
int s=0;
printf("請輸入一個三位數\n");
scanf("%d",&num);
if(num>=100&&num<=999)
{
ge=num%10;
shi = num/10%10;
= num/100;
s= ge+shi+;
printf("三位數各位之和為%d\n",s);
}
else
printf("輸入錯誤,請重新輸入!") ;
}

❻ C語言編寫一個程序,實現如下功能:從鍵盤輸入一個三位數,求各位數字之和.簡單點!!!

#include"stdio.h"

voidmain()

{

intn,sum=0;

printf("請輸入一個三位數:");

scanf("%d",&n);

sum=n/100+n%100/10+n%10;//百位數+十位數+個位數

printf("這個三位數各位數字之和是%d ",sum);

}

結果:

❼ C語言編程題目:輸入一個三位數,輸出各個數位上的數字及它們的和。

答案:

int Total;
scanf("%d", &Total);
//百位
int m = Total / 100;
int n = Total - m * 100;
n = n / 10;
int t = Total % 10;

//m n t分別為百位 十位 個位 求和
int nRet = m + n + t;

❽ C語言:輸入一個三位的整數,計算其每位數字的累加之和。

#include<stdio.h>
#include<math.h>
int main()
{
int a,x,y,s,sum;
printf("輸入一個三位整數:");
scanf("%d",&a);
x=a/100; //a除以100取整,就是取百位數
y=a/10%10; //a除以10取整再除以10取余,就是取十位數
s=a%10; //a除以10取余,就是個位數
sum=x+y+s; //三個數位相加之和
printf("每位數字累加之和為sum=%d",sum);
return 0;
}

❾ 用C語言從鍵盤輸入一個三位整數,求各位數字以及它們立方和並將結果輸出

scanf(%d,&a);//a是一個三位數
int b =a/100;
int c = (a%100)/10;
int d = a-b*100-c*10;
printf(百位%d,十位%d,個位%d,b,c,d);
printf("立方和為:+%d",b*b*b+c*c*c+d*d*d);

❿ c語言程序設計 三位數分解求累加和

#include <stdio.h>
int main()
{
printf("請輸入一個3位的正整數n:");
int integer = 0;
scanf("%d", &integer);
int sum = 0;
sum += (integer/100);
integer = integer%100;
sum += (integer/10);
sum += (integer%10);
printf("各位數字之和sum為%d\n", sum);
return 0;
}

請採納我吧。

閱讀全文

與用c編譯如何求三位數各位數之和相關的資料

熱點內容
秒錶倒計時單片機程序 瀏覽:737
單片機小學期交通燈 瀏覽:591
如何查app文件在哪裡 瀏覽:65
美的美居app有什麼功能 瀏覽:410
安卓手機如何刷為華為系統 瀏覽:394
伺服器如何搭建自己的簡歷 瀏覽:580
編譯的程序名稱 瀏覽:629
安卓機如何使用蘋果同款鬧鍾 瀏覽:623
說文解字中華書局pdf 瀏覽:149
java反序列化xml 瀏覽:456
小藍app為什麼消息未連接 瀏覽:151
甲烷是不是可壓縮流體 瀏覽:366
別克車怎麼連接安卓手機投屏 瀏覽:566
負債凈值比率演算法 瀏覽:721
命令行窗口怎麼添加目錄 瀏覽:385
37的八位數源碼 瀏覽:932
空調壓縮機連接桿抱死 瀏覽:632
汽車空調壓縮機進了泥土怎麼辦 瀏覽:710
寧德有什麼好的買菜app 瀏覽:669
cocos2dx游戲開發之旅源碼 瀏覽:460